Technology Mgr

American Electric Power · Gahanna, OH · 3 wk ago
On-siteEngineering$137k–$178k/yrFull-time

Responsible for the strategic direction of a technology domain, services, or process within a broader strategy of a Business Unit (BU) customer or technology functional area. Promotes and applies Technology processes and solutions to meet the needs and align with the strategies of that BU customer or technology functional area. Responsible for directly managing and developing technology staff, building and sustaining collaborative relationships with operating companies, BUs, and technology teams. Lead the teams to complete projects and/or services and perform all technology work activities via efficient processes and effective use of resources.
